Enhanced oil recovery is a process for ensuring optimum oil extraction from an oil well by adopting new and advanced scientific technologies. The term oil recovery indicates the process of extracting oil from oil well to the surface. The basic intention behind using enhanced oil recovery process or EOR is to obtain maximum oil from the oil reserve.
Basically the process of oil recovery consists of three stages. In the first stage or the primary stage, oil from the well will be extracted with the help of the natural pressure within the reservoir. The fluids that contain hydrocarbon formation are being commonly used to stimulate the oil wells at the first stage of oil extraction.
The process of extracting oil that remains in the well after the primary stage of oil extraction is then extracted through the secondary stage of oil recovery. Gas injection and water flooding are the commonly used techniques at this second stage of oil recovery.
It is in the tertiary recovery or the third stage of oil recovery that the enhanced oil recovery technology will be effectively utilized to get the maximum possible oil from the oil reservoir. Gas injection technology is the most commonly used enhanced oil recovery technology. It is the process by which natural gases like carbon dioxide, nitrogen or other similar gases that are capable of expanding or stimulating the oil well injected to the oil well whereby additional oil is pushed to the surface. Another advantage of using this EOR technology is that these gases are capable of brining maximum oil from the oil well by lowering the viscosity of the fluid in the well.
The use of carbon dioxide injection as the EOR technique has its own merits and demerits. The main advantage of using CO2 injection technique is that it can be stored away from the atmosphere and so it can be effectively used as a tool to combat the threat of global warming. But the additional oil that is extracted from the oil will add more carbon dioxide to the atmosphere while combustion and the benefits that we have achieved by offsetting CO2 will be of no use with this.
The other techniques used of EOR are the thermal recovery method and chemical injection method. Thermal recovery method makes use of steam to improve the flow of oil from the well. In chemical injection technology of EOR the polymers are injected to enhance the free flow of remaining oil from the oil reservoir. Detergent like surfactants are also being utilized by the petroleum plants to recover more oil from the oil well while adopting chemical injection method of enhanced oil recovery technique.
Only ten percent of the oil from the oil well will be able to be extracted at the preliminary stage of oil extraction. Twenty to forty percent of the total oil in the well will come out in the secondary stage whereas the new techniques involved in EOR technology ensures thirty to sixty percent of oil extraction of the total reserve. Therefore EOR technology enhances the life of an oil well.
